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
We begin by inspecting the affected area to identify the source of the water and assess the extent of the damage. This helps us develop a plan to extract the water and dry the area efficiently. Our team uses specialized equipment to detect moisture levels and identify areas that need attention. You can trust our experts to find the problem and provide a clear plan for resolution.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Once we’ve identified the source of the water, our team uses specialized equipment to extract it from the carpet pad. This involves using a combination of wet vacuums and extraction tools to remove as much water as possible. We work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your home back to normal as quickly as possible. You can rely on our team to get the job done right.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After extracting the water, our team focuses on drying the area to prevent mold growth and further damage. We use specialized equipment to remove excess moisture and humidity, ensuring your carpet pad is dry and free of moisture. This step is crucial in preventing secondary damage and ensuring your home remains safe and healthy. Our team takes the time to get it right.
Step 4: Monitoring and Follow-up
Once the area is dry, our team monitors the area to ensure it remains safe and healthy. We check for any signs of moisture or mold growth and provide follow-up services as needed. Carpet Pad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water stain or discoloration | Yes | No | You can likely remove the stain yourself with a cleaning solution. |
| Visible water damage or warping | No | Yes | Water damage can lead to mold growth and structural issues if left untreated. |
| Musty odors or unpleasant moisture | No | Yes | Mold growth can be difficult to remove and may need professional equipment and expertise. |
| Large water damage or extensive discoloration | No | Yes | Large water damage can need specialized equipment and expertise to remove and dry the affected area. |
| Uncertain or unknown water source | No | Yes | Identifying the source of the water is crucial to preventing further damage and ensuring your home remains safe and healthy. |

Carpet Pad Water Extraction Cost in Donnelly, ID
The cost of Carpet Pad Water Ext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Donnelly, ID. We provide free estimates and work with you to develop a customized plan to meet your needs and budget. Our team is committed to delivering high-quality results at a fair price. Here are some estimated costs for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Small water stain removal | $200 – $500 | Size of the stain and type of carpet material |
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the affected area and severity of the damage |
| Carpet pad repl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area and type of carpet material |
| Mold remediation | $500 – $2,000 | Size of the affected area and type of mold |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We provide free estimates and work with you to develop a customized plan to meet your needs and budget.
